Abstract
A generic search is presented for the associated production of a Z boson or a photon with an additional unspecified massive particle X, pp → pp + Z / γ + X , in proton-tagged events from proton–proton collisions at s=13TeV , recorded in 2017 with the CMS detector and the CMS-TOTEM precision proton spectrometer. The missing mass spectrum is analysed in the 600–1600 GeV range and a fit is performed to search for possible deviations from the background expectation. No significant excess in data with respect to the background predictions has been observed. Model-independent upper limits on the visible production cross section of pp → pp + Z / γ + X are set.
